RE: Getting ticks off you?
Ticks contract diseases to humans not by the bite. The tick gorges itself on your blood and when it can't eat anymore, it essentially throws up back into your blood stream. this is how the diseases are transmitted from ticks. So, when you irritate a tick, you risk the tick throwing up back into your blood and infecting you. This is why an easy pull from the head of the tick is the best method of removing a tick.
